Vienna M. Wackershauser, 59, of Platteville, Wisconsin, died on Thursday, June 4, 2021. A service to celebrate her life will be held at 12:00 p.m. (Noon) on Saturday, June 12, 2021 at the Melby Funeral Home & Crematory, Platteville. Pastor Mary Ann Floerke will officiate. Burial will be at Mount Pleasant Cemetery, Cuba City. Friends may call from 10:00 a.m. until the time of the service at the Melby Funeral Home & Crematory, Platteville. Memorials may be made to the Vienna M. Wackershauser Memorial Fund. Online condolences can be made at www.melbyfh.com.
Vienna was born on October 9, 1961 in Hazel Green, Wisconsin, daughter of Larry and Nancy (Seemeyer) Fidler. She was united in marriage to Thomas Wackershauser on November 3, 1979 at the Platteville United Methodist Church. Vienna graduated from Platteville High School, Class of 1980, and attended SWTC, Fennimore, where she became a certified CNA. She worked at Orchard Manor, Lancaster, Land's End, Dodgeville and at the Lyght House, rural Platteville until she retired. She enjoyed watching the Packers, Brewers, and following NASCAR. She was an avid reader, enjoyed sewing, doing puzzles and flamingos.
Vienna is survived by her husband, Tom; two children, Sarah Wackershauser and Tommy (Brittany) Wackershauser; grandson, Maverick Wackershauser; sisters, Karla Fidler and Cheryl Jamieson; father-in-law, Henry “Joe” (Barb) Wackershauser; brother-in-law, Dave (Lorraine) Wackershauser; sister-in-law, Marcia (Bruce) Kyes; aunts; uncles; nieces; nephews; great nieces and nephews; and cousins. She was preceded in death by her parents, brother, Timothy Fidler and grandma, Millie Faith, and grandfahers Nathan Seemeyer and Donovan Faith.
